Bermuda Hospitals Board Relies on DCS for DC Design, Network Optimization

The Bermuda Hospitals Board (BHB) manages Bermuda’s public healthcare system, operating two key facilities:
- King Edward VII Memorial Hospital in Paget Parish
- Mid-Atlantic Wellness Institute in Devonshire Parish
These institutions rely on a complex supply chain with multiple off-site storage locations to deliver critical healthcare services.
Project Background
With the DCS consulting team, BHB launched a two-phase initiative to optimize its supply chain by:
- Designing a centralized, scalable distribution center (DC) to consolidate materials and support growth through 2029.
- Conducting a comprehensive network assessment to enhance operational efficiency, technology integration, and performance.
Phase I: Distribution Center Design
DCS developed a modern, future-ready distribution center design to meet BHB’s operational needs. Key activities included:
- Data Analysis: Evaluated historical stock keeping unit (SKU) velocity, inventory levels, and order flows to forecast facility requirements.
- Conceptual Layout: Designed distinct zones for receiving, storage, picking, packing, and inventory control.
- Technology Evaluation: Assessed order fulfillment methods (OFMs), identifying opportunities for automation (e.g., voice picking, pick-to-light systems).
- Implementation Plan: Delivered detailed material handling equipment (MHE) specifications, space utilization strategies, and a phased roadmap aligned with budgets and priorities.
The design and enhanced operational tools and processes ensured scalability, optimized workflows, and cost-effective implementation by creating transparent, co-developed solutions throughout the entire BHB network.
Phase II: Network Assessment
DCS also performed a network assessment aimed to enhance visibility, standardization, and control across the supply chain. Key focus areas included:
- Process Review: Analyzed receiving, put-away, inventory control, order fulfillment, and shipping processes.
- Technology Upgrades: Evaluated the warehouse management system (WMS), recommending enhancements for real-time inventory visibility and remote site integration.
- Performance Optimization: Identified efficiency gains through updated performance metrics, streamlined process flows, and optimized equipment usage.
- Roadmap Delivery: Provided a prioritized plan with capital estimates for immediate, mid-term, and long-term improvements.
Results and Impact
The initiative transformed BHB’s supply chain into a more efficient, scalable, and patient-focused system. Key outcomes included:
- Optimized Distribution Center: Improved workflows with proven solution designs as well as a 42% storage utilization rate through efficient zoning and slotting tools enabling faster throughput and reduced operational delays.
- Scalable Automation: Identified flexible automation options (e.g., modernized scanned put away, cycle counting and pick/pack operations) to support future demand.
- Enhanced Network Visibility: Improved inventory management across the DC and remote locations through standardized processes and real-time tracking through an upgraded Warehouse Management System visibility tool.
- Operational Consistency: Introduced actionable KPIs that were shared throughout the entire workforce, reducing waste and improving resource utilization.
- Patient-Centric Logistics: Ensured reliable, timely delivery of critical supplies to healthcare teams using the enhanced tools and processes developed in the project.
